About this role

Job Description:

We're looking for a Revenue Marketing Manager to own the marketing partnership with our Enterprise sales team in North America. You'll be the go-to marketing partner for account executives, their leaders, and BDRs - someone who understands the Enterprise buying journey, earns trust with sellers, and consistently delivers programs that open doors, deepen customer relationships, and help close business. This role is hands-on: you'll run customer webinars, field events, and targeted gifting campaigns, then measure what worked and do more of it. You won't be handed a playbook; you'll help write one.

What you’ll do:

  • Build strong working relationships with Enterprise account executives, sales managers, and BDRs; join their meetings and QBRs to stay close to pipeline, territory priorities, and account-level needs

  • Bring proactive marketing ideas to the table and serve as a strategic advisor by uncovering opportunities and addressing business challenges that support their accounts

  • Act as the connective tissue between the Enterprise sales team and the broader marketing organization, creating shared goals and joint efforts

  • Own the end-to-end execution of customer webinars, such as topic selection, speaker coordination, promotion, production, and follow-up

  • Plan and implement field events (dinners, roundtables, and local experiences) that bring together prospects, customers, and sales

  • Run targeted gifting and direct mail campaigns that support account-based plays and keep Pluralsight top of mind with key buyers

  • Manage program logistics: vendor relationships, budgets, timelines, invitations, communications, and lead handoff to sales

  • Track attendance, engagement, pipeline influence, and conversion for every program; share regular performance updates with sales and marketing collaborators with clear takeaways and recommendations

  • Use data to decide what to repeat, what to adjust, and what to stop

About us:

Pluralsight provides the only learning platform dedicated to accelerating the technology skills and capabilities of today’s tech workforce. Thousands of companies, government organizations and individuals around the world rely on Pluralsight to support critical technology skill development in areas that are crucial to innovation including artificial intelligence, cloud computing, cybersecurity, software development, and machine learning. We offer highly curated content developed by vetted technology experts, industry leading skill assessments, and hands on, immersive learning experiences designed to help individuals skill-up faster.
